> Some new hash flow will be supported to expend the flow hash capability,
> the input set are the 5 tuple for regular ip pattern and also GTPU inner ip
> pattern, and the session id for NAT-T ESP protocol, the l3 src/dst and the teid
> for GTPU_IP protocol.
